Version Text
Hebrew וישלח המלך את־יהודי לקחת את־המגלה ויקחה מלשכת אלישמע הספר ויקראה יהודי באזני המלך ובאזני כל־השרים העמדים מעל המלך׃
Greek και απεστειλεν ο βασιλευς τον ιουδιν λαβειν το χαρτιον και ελαβεν αυτο εξ οικου ελισαμα και ανεγνω ιουδιν εις τα ωτα του βασιλεως και εις τα ωτα παντων των αρχοντων των εστηκοτων περι τον
Latin Misitque rex Judi ut sumeret volumen : qui tollens illud de gazophylacio Elisamæ scribæ, legit, audiente rege et universis principibus qui stabant circa regem.
KJV So the king sent Jehudi to fetch the roll: and he took it out of Elishama the scribe's chamber. And Jehudi read it in the ears of the king, and in the ears of all the princes which stood beside the king.
WEB So the king sent Jehudi to get the scroll; and he took it out of the room of Elishama the scribe. Jehudi read it in the ears of the king, and in the ears of all the princes who stood beside the king.
